The First Coast News brand was first used by the stations on April 27, 2000, in the wake of Gannett's acquisition of WJXX the month before and consequent expansion of what had primarily been WTLV's news department. Previously owned by Gannett, First Coast News, which includes WJXX-ABC 25 and WTLV-NBC 12, was part of a company split that formed TEGNA Inc., which is made up primarily of the former Gannett television stations.
